Pedro Zitko is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Social Psychology and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Pedro Zitko has authored 49 papers receiving a total of 813 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 16 papers in General Health Professions, 12 papers in Social Psychology and 11 papers in Health. Recurrent topics in Pedro Zitko's work include Mental Health Treatment and Access (10 papers), Health disparities and outcomes (9 papers) and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development (7 papers). Pedro Zitko is often cited by papers focused on Mental Health Treatment and Access (10 papers), Health disparities and outcomes (9 papers) and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development (7 papers). Pedro Zitko collaborates with scholars based in Chile, United Kingdom and United States. Pedro Zitko's co-authors include Ricardo Araya, Dheeraj Rai, Kelvyn Jones, John Lynch, Niina Markkula, Graciela Rojas, Vania Martínez, Glyn Lewis, Venetsanos Mavreas and Stefanos Bellos and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, The British Journal of Psychiatry and Journal of Affective Disorders.
